Product Overview

Chloranilic Acid, with the chemical formula 2,5-Dichloro-3,6-Dihydroxy-2,5-Cyclohexadiene-1,4-Dione, is a highly specialized chemical compound known for its extrapure grade, ensuring a purity level of 98%. This compound is characterized by its unique structure, which includes a combination of chlorine and hydroxyl groups, making it a valuable reagent in various laboratory applications. Its high purity level makes it ideal for use in research and educational settings, where precision and reliability are paramount. Chloranilic Acid is often utilized in organic synthesis, chemical analysis, and as a standard in analytical chemistry. FAQs

1. What are the primary applications of Chloranilic Acid?

Chloranilic Acid is primarily used in organic synthesis, chemical analysis, and as a standard in analytical chemistry.

2. Is Chloranilic Acid compatible with other chemicals?

Chloranilic Acid is generally compatible with a wide range of chemicals, but it is important to consult safety data sheets for specific compatibility information.

3. What are some alternatives to Chloranilic Acid?

Alternatives to Chloranilic Acid include other halogenated quinones and similar compounds used in organic synthesis and chemical analysis.

4. How should Chloranilic Acid be stored?

Chloranilic Acid should be stored in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ight and heat sources, to maintain its stability and purity.
